Core Curriculum & Learning Pillars
1. Mastering Context Windows & Prompt Architecture
The foundation of effective AI-driven coding lies in context management. Large language models are only as effective as the context provided to them. This module teaches you how to construct modular system prompts, feed existing repository files into Claude correctly, and structure multi-file project specifications so the AI maintains perfect logic across complex features without hallucinating or breaking existing code.
2. Building Full-Stack Applications from Scratch
Theory is immediately put into practice through real-world build projects. The course guides students step-by-step through setting up modern development stacks—leveraging popular frameworks like React, Next.js, Node.js, and Supabase. You learn how to instruct Claude to build database schemas, API routes, user authentication systems, and polished user interfaces seamlessly.
3. Advanced Debugging & Refactoring Strategies
Even the best AI models generate bugs or sub-optimal code. A major focus of the curriculum is developing “AI literacy”—the ability to read, evaluate, and refine generated output. Duncan Rogoff breaks down systematic approaches to error handling, performance optimization, automated test generation, and refactoring legacy codebases using strategic prompt chains.
4. Deploying, Scaling, and Autonomous Agents
Building locally is only half the battle. The final sections cover production deployment, connecting continuous integration/contin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ines, and setting up automated workflows. Furthermore, the course delves into advanced topics like combining Claude with local code editors, terminal tools, and AI agent frameworks to handle repetitive tasks autonomously.
